Program Announced
agIdeas International Design Week is an annual design festival that is a celebration of the best in design & creativity at the Melbourne Convention and Exhibition Centre from 21-25 May 2012.
Now in its 22nd year, agIdeas is one of Australia’s largest and longest running design events attracting a national and an international audience.
It offers an extraordinary program of events that celebrate design excellence and promotes the value of design driven innovation. It understands that design shapes the world in which we live and champions design excellence. International creative leaders and home grown talent engage in an exciting program that will look at what is happening in design today from across the design spectrum – graphic design, product design, motion graphics, design for film and television, new media, web design, animation, illustration, typography, architecture, fashion and textiles, sound design, performance art, and advertising.
‘We always look for creative people who have pushed the boundaries and excelled; those who have innovated and impacted on how we live and those that have worked to add value and a competitive edge to a whole range of businesses. Design is really all around us and we hope to broaden the understanding of what good design is and why it is important’, says Ken Cato Creative Director, agIdeas.
40 of the world’s creative leaders will converge on Melbourne, including: Mauro Porcini the global design director of American giant 3M; Marian Bantjes hailed for her typography and embellishments and author of the recent I Wonder; Dale Herigstad is at the forefront of interactive television design; Ree Treweek art director and production designer at Shy the Sun brings imagination and new dimensions to her on-screen designs, recently working with Ribena on their latest animation advertising campaign; Poras Chaudhary photojournalist best known for his intense and striking colour and composition; Ash Keating is a visual artist engaging strongly with social and environmental issues. Art Paul (Playboy Magazine) will present via Skype.
agIdeas is made up of a number of distinct events and these include:
International Design Forum: agIdeas Design Intelligence,
Wednesday 23 May, 9:00am – 5:30pm; Thursday 24 May, 10:00am – 6:30pm; and
Friday 25 May, 9:00am – 5:30pm
Three day conference with 40 design leaders who will share their design insights and experiences with an audience of more than 2500 designers and tertiary students daily.
agIdeas Advantage: Business Breakfast,Thursday 24 May, 7.00am to 10.00am
A business breakfast that presents case studies on the tangible benefits of design and using design as an effective tool for business. Presented in association with Sussan and Sportsgirl.
agIdeas Design for Business and Industry: International Research Conference, Tuesday 22 May
This one day conference provides design and business researchers, educators and practitioners with the opportunity to present peer-reviewed research papers on the theme ‘Design as a strategic resource: adding value to business and industry’.

agIdeas Futures: Secondary School Design Forum, Wednesday 23 May
Design Course Expo, 4.00 – 6.00pm & Speaker Presentations, 6.00pm to 8.30pm
A two hour forum exploring the insights into design careers from international creative leaders and a design course expo where major tertiary design colleges hold stalls with information on career pathways. Presented in association with Australian Academy of Design.
agIdeas Next: Children for Design, Tuesday 22 May, 10.00am to 1.30pm
A forum and workshops lead by visiting designers to encourage primary school children to become champions of good design. agIdeas 2012 NewStar
Travelling Scholarship Program. Winners to be announced at agIdeas International Design Forum. The winning entries will win international design experience at a leading design studio or at Fabrica the Benetton Groups Creative Laboratory in Italy.
Open to tertiary students and new graduates.
agIdeas Workshops, Monday 21 May, 9.30am to 4.00pm
A unique opportunity for design professionals and students to spend a full day with some of the most highly regarded international designers. This year, the workshops will be conducted by: Dana Arnett USA; Autobahn (Maarten Dullemeijer and Rob Stolte), The Netherlands; David Berman, Canada; and Ree Treweek, South Africa.
Presented in association with Australia Graphic Design Association.
agIdeas Studio Access, Wednesday 23 May, 6.30pm to 8.30pm
Design students and new graduates will have the opportunity to meet designers whose work they admire in their studio and will gain an understanding of how they
work. Close to 40 of Melbourne’s leading studios will host small groups over dinner & drinks.
agIdeas disCourse, Friday 25 May, 7.00pm to 11.00pm
Held at the National Gallery of Victoria, this gala dinner is the largest social event on Melbourne’s annual design calendar. It’s a celebration of design excellence
where the esteemed international guests unite with local luminaries and eminent design educators bring to a close agIdeas International Design Week. Presented in association with Artisan.

agIdeas was founded in 1991 by leading Australian designer Ken Cato. He is currently agIdeas Creative Director and Chairman of international design agency Cato
Purnell Partners. agIdeas is managed by the Design Foundation. Since it began 440 of the world’s leading designers have been guests, an audience of over 70,000 have attended, 21,000 have come together at the social gatherings, 40 young designers have benefited from travelling scholarships, 4,000 volunteers have
helped organise and stage agIdeas and 200,000 people have visited the Melbourne Museum during the NewStar Exhibition.
